Description
Ryouma is a member of the ancient Fūma Clan, locked in a centuries-long conflict with the rival Yasha Clan. He arrives at Hakuo Academy with fellow Fūma ninja to aid protagonist Kojirou after the Yasha Clan allies with rival school Seishikan.
A stoic and disciplined warrior, Ryouma strictly adheres to the Fūma code, frequently invoking "Shinobi Law" as his guiding principle. This rigidity shapes his tactical choices during battles against the Yasha Generals. His combat style includes the visually distinctive "Fuma Shikyoken" technique, enhanced with digital effects in adaptations.
His relationship with Hakuo Academy student Ranko Yagyū marks a significant arc. Her acts of kindness challenge his detached demeanor, prompting him to gradually acknowledge his own humanity beyond being a clan weapon and softening his initial rigidity.
Ryouma participates in key battles throughout the conflict, notably facing Musashi Asuka, the Yasha Clan leader. Their confrontations receive greater narrative focus than other clashes, highlighting Ryouma's importance within the Fūma ranks. Following the deaths of Fūma members Kou and Rinpyo during the war, Ryouma continues fighting alongside surviving comrades like Kirikaze and Ryūhō in subsequent conflicts against the New Fūma Clan.
